February 4, 2024

Happier Nurses Result in Healthier Patients | 53:12

Amy Ruff, BSN, RN, National Director of TM for Nurses, discusses a randomized, controlled study published in Journal of Nursing Administration showing that TM practice significantly reduced PTSD and anxiety by more than half in frontline nurses during the COVID-19 pandemic. She also talks about a study showing the TM technique significantly reduced “compassion fatigue” and improved resilience for nurses.
